Generic Electronic (Gem)/Central Timer (Ctm) Module

MODULE - GENERIC ELECTRONIC (GEM)/CENTRAL TIMER (CTM)

REMOVAL

1. CAUTION: Prior to removal of the GEM, it is necessary to upload module configuration information to a diagnostic tool. This information needs to be downloaded into the new module once installed.

Disconnect the battery ground cable.

2. Remove the steering column cover.







3. Remove the (A) bulkhead electrical connectors from the (B) instrument panel fuse junction panel.







4. Remove the (A) instrument panel fuse junction panel bolts and remove the (B) interior fuse junction panel nuts.







5. Disconnect the (A) GEM/CTM electrical connectors from the (B) GEM/CTM.







6. Remove the screws and the GEM/CTM.

INSTALLATION












1. CAUTION: Once the new GEM is installed, it is necessary to download the module configuration information from the diagnostic tool into the new module.

To install, reverse the removal procedure.
- Check for correct operation.
